About

Ni Mergas Guy (also know as ¿Qué pasó muchacho?) is the nickname given to "Pedrito", a drunk guy showed in Mexico´s national TV . The video shows this guy coming home late, with some beers in a black bag bought in an illegal beer store, whlie cops were doing an operation against this stores, with reporters filming it, all of this in Torreón, México. The police were trying to take his beers away. One of the cops says ¿Qué pasó muchacho? (What´s up boy?), making it a well- known phrase in the video, but the main phrase of the video is when “Pedrito” says Ni Mergas. There are other funny phrases like “Como que pinchi me va dar ni madre huey? “ o “te haces pa’lla o te hago pa’lla”. The video has 3,960,250 views as seen in August 2012. see also El canaca,Dios Eolo and El trapo.

Origin

The video was first seen in the Televisa Guadalajara news in its section "El show de la Barandilla" a Cops-esque show about oft-comical police interventions against drunkards.

Spread

Several remixes and Versus like videos were uploaded after this video in Youtube, making it pretty popular in 2007 and 2008. He was also mocked in radio channels.

Pedrito

Not so much is known about the main protaginist in this video. His first name is Pedro, he lives in Torreón, he works as a Taco Vendor in Cepeda street, between Presidente Carranza street and Hidalgo street, also in Torreón. He later appeared twice in TV: he was interviewed by the Rinpanchón clown in "Mira que Bonito" tv show in Torreón local TV when he was working.



He appeared in the same show as the special guest later.
